If you’re at the right place at the right time, with the right equipment, this is possible.

Last night, with guidance from https://transit-finder.com/, I positioned myself along the narrow line where the International #SpaceStation would pass between me and the nearly full moon.

I used a Fujifilm X-T4 shooting 4K video through a Celestron 8” SCT to capture the pass. Then, back at the computer this morning, put together these views with PIPP, Registax, and GIMP.

Quite pleased. My best yet.

What a nice late Christmas present to see this out in #JACS now. This paper shows how chemical proteomics can assist target deconvolution in the discovery of new covalent antibiotics against MRSA. Great work by first authors Alexander Bakker and Ioli Kotsogianni from the groups of @mariovdstelt and Nathaniel Martin. Happy that the work I did for my master’s thesis could contribute to this story. @LED3hub
